## 2.9.0 — Setting renamed for the bulk-edit service

The admin table in Ledgerpane now performs bulk edits through the Rowhand worker, and the old flag BULKEDIT_AUTH was renamed ROWHAND_EDIT_SECRET for clarity. New team members should note that the legacy name no longer falls back silently; startup fails with a clear error. After pulling this release, open the service's `.env` and place the new secret on the line directly below this migration note.

sealed setting: ARCHIVE_KEY3=8d0

Subject: Key rotation — Lattersview partition service

We rotated keys for the Lattersview partition scheduler this morning. Old keys stop working Friday.

Context: the ledger tables are now partitioned by month instead of by tenant. The scheduler creates next month's partition on the 25th and drops anything older than 18 months. Your backfill scripts must target the monthly partitions directly; writes to the parent table will be rejected.

Update your local config before running anything. Use the key below for the scheduler API.

API key for fadug-fafof: kto7_7rjklQM

**14:22** — On-call confirmed that the Quillbrook schema registry began rejecting valid event definitions after the cache node in the Ostermere cluster restarted with a stale snapshot. Producers fell back to embedded schemas, masking the failure for nine minutes. Mitigation was a forced cache rebuild. The exact registry build involved is recorded below for cross-checking.

trace token, fafog-kageg: htk4_98e6

## Changelog — Font vendoring defaults changed

As of this release, the Bracken UI build no longer fetches third-party fonts at build time. All typefaces used by the Lanternwell suite are now vendored into the repo under a dedicated assets directory, and the fetch step is skipped by default. If you're onboarding, nothing to install — the fonts travel with the checkout. The build flags controlling this behavior are listed below.

settings of hadup-yafog:
LAMAEL_PIN=3761
LAMAEL_TENANT=istmir
LAMAEL_METRICS_HOST=metrics.lamael.plorvasys.test
LAMAEL_SEAL=seal_8ea68500
LAMAEL_STANDBY_TEAM=fraok